R.V.R. & J.C. College of Engineering (Autonomous), Guntur-522019, A.P.

R-20

EC323 DIGITAL IMAGE PROCESSING L T P C Int Ext


3 - - 3 30 70

COURSE OBJECTIVES:
1. To gain knowledge of fundamentals of image processing.
2. To gain knowledge in image enhancement, restoration, compression, segmentation.
3. To determine the suitable Image enhancement, restoration and Segmentation techniques for a given
application.
4. To determine the suitable image compression algorithms.

COURSE OUTCOMES:
After successful completion of the course, the students are able to
1. Understand image processing fundamentals.
2. Understand image enhancement, restoration, compression, segmentation, representation and
descriptors.
3. Apply filtering techniques for enhancement, restoration and segmentation on images.
4. Apply compression algorithms on images.

UNIT I Text Book - 1 [CO:1] (12)

INTRODUCTION: Origin of Digital Image Processing, Fields that use Digital Image Processing,
Fundamental Steps in Digital Image Processing, Components of an Image Processing System.

DIGITAL IMAGE FUNDAMENTALS: Elements of Visual Perception, Image Sensing and


Acquisition,Image Sampling and Quantization, Basic Relationships between Pixels, Linear and
Nonlinear Operations, Arithmetic and Logical Operations.

UNIT II Text Book - 1 [CO:2,3] (12)

IMAGE ENHANCEMENT IN SPATIAL DOMAIN: Some Basic Intensity transformation Functions,


Histogram Processing, Smoothing Spatial Filters, Sharpening Spatial Filters.

IMAGE ENHANCEMENT IN FREQUENCY DOMAIN: Basics of Filtering in the Frequency Domain,


Correspondence Between Filtering in the Spatial and Frequency Domains, Image Smoothing using
Frequency Domain Filters, Image Sharpening using Frequency Domain Filters, Homomorphic Filtering.

UNIT III Text Book - 1 [CO:2,3,4] (12)

IMAGE RESTORATION: Noise Models, Restoration in the Presence of Noise only-Spatial Filtering,
Periodic Noise Reduction by Frequency Domain Filtering; Linear, Position - Invariant Degradations,
Inverse Filtering, Wiener Filtering.

IMAGE COMPRESSION: Fundamentals, Image Compression Methods- Huffman Coding, Arithmetic


Coding, LZW Coding, Run-Length Coding, Bit-Plane Coding, Lossless Predictive Coding, Lossy
Predictive Coding,Block Transform Coding.

UNIT IV Text Book - 1,2 [CO:2,3] (12)

IMAGE SEGMENTATION: Point, Line and Edge Detection, Thresholding-Basic Global Thresholding,
Optimum Global Thresholding, Region Based Segmentation.

IMAGE REPRESENTATION AND DESCRIPTION: Representation Schemes, Boundary Descriptors,


Regional Descriptors.
